Bu sayfada, her bir SEAT_*
ve STEERING_WHEEL_*
araç özelliğinin, araçtaki bir koltuğun ve direksiyonun konumu ve hareketiyle nasıl ilişkili olduğu açıklanmaktadır.
SEAT_*
ve STEERING_WHEEL_*
özellikleri, hardware/interfaces
dizinindeki VehicleProperty.aidl
ve packages/services/Car
dizinindeki VehiclePropertyIds.java
içinde tanımlanan ve CarPropertyManager
aracılığıyla kullanıma sunulan araç özellikleridir. Bu özellikleri kullanarak koltukta ve direksiyon simidinde yaygın olarak bulunan tüm aktüatörlerin durumunu ve hareketini kontrol edin. Örneğin, koltuk sırtlığının açısı ve hareketi SEAT_BACKREST_ANGLE_1_*
özellikleri aracılığıyla dijitalleştirilir.
Özellikler
Her aktüatöre iki özellik eklenir:
_POS
, koltuğun ve direksiyonun kontrol ettiği parçanın mevcut konumunu açıklar._MOVE
, parçanın hangi yönde ve hangi hızda hareket ettiğini açıklar. Parça hareketsizken0
olarak ayarlanır.
Ayrıntılı tasarımlar
Her şemadaki vurgulanan kısımlar, koltuk ve direksiyonun hangi bölümlerinin ilgili özelliğin değeri değiştirildiği için hareket ettiğini gösterir. Dolu ok, _MOVE
özelliği pozitif olduğunda (örneğin, _POS
özelliği artarken) hareketi, noktalı ok ise _MOVE
özelliği negatif olduğunda (örneğin, _POS
özelliği azalırken) hareketi gösterir.